At a neuronal level, tDCS modulates cortical excitability by shifting the resting membrane potential in a polarity-dependent way: anodal stimulation increases the spontaneous firing rate, while cathodal decreases it. tDCS involves delivery of weak direct currents (0.5–2.0 mA) to the targeted cortical area using saline-soaked electrodes with a battery-powered generator. The basics of Transcranial Magnetic Stimulation (TMS): TMS is a neuromodulatory technique which applies magnetic pulses to the brain via a ‘coil.’ An electric current is delivered to the coil, which acts as the magnetic field generator in the procedure. TMS: TMS devices send a short, high-power electrical surge to the coil. Spaulding Rehabilitation Hospital . This rapid phasic current flow generates a transient magnetic field, which propagates in space and in turn induces a secondary current in the brain that is capable of depolarising neurons if the coil is held over the subject’s head (Pascual-Leone et al., 2002).
